EARTH HOUR PDF Print E-mail
Written by Delphi   

With over 1 billion people in 77 countries and 680 cities, including Cape Town, already participating, Earth Hour 2009 is set to be the world's first global vote on the issue of climate change. Voting takes place on 28 March 2009 at 8pm SA time. You vote by switching off your lights for an hour ... and we'll be doing just that at Vision Serpent.

To further honour our commitment to combating climate change, we are charging a R10 environmental cleaning levy per car at the gate. A percentage of this amount will go towards planting trees at MalPlaas in Botrivier as a way to balance the party's carbon footprint. The rest will go towards recycling all of the waste generated at the event by Mr Recycle. Hopefully this levy will also encourage punters to organise car pools. Remember to reduce litter and leave no trace. Let's not party at the expense of the venues or the planet!
